News summary

Melanie Müller, a German pop singer and former reality TV personality, has been fined €80,000 (approximately $89,000) by a Leipzig court for repeatedly making a Nazi salute during a concert in September 2022 and for possessing illegal drugs. The court found her guilty of using symbols associated with unconstitutional organizations, dismissing her defense that the gestures were merely meant to energize the crowd. Video evidence presented in court showed Müller engaging in gestures and chants linked to Nazi slogans, with the judge noting her actions as deliberate. Additionally, drugs discovered during a search of her home included cocaine and ecstasy, which she claimed belonged to a friend. The fine imposed was substantially higher than the €5,700 sought by prosecutors, and Müller expressed shock at the verdict. Her legal team plans to appeal the decision, citing negative media coverage that they argue has affected her career.
